President Vladimir Putin says the risk of a nuclear war is rising, but insists Russia has not 'gone mad' and that nuclear weapons could only be used as 'a response to an attack'.

Wed 7 Dec 2022 at 5:08pm

The Russian leader insists the country had not "gone mad" when talking about the dangers of nuclear weapons.abc.net.au/news/putin-says-risk-of-nuclear-war-rising-ukraine-russia/101746972Russian President Vladimir Putin says the risk of a nuclear war is rising, but insists Russia had not "gone mad" and that nuclear weapons could only be used as "a response to an attack".

The Russian leader was speaking at a televised session of his human rights council and was responding to a comment about Ukraine shelling areas of the Russian-controlled Donetsk region.Mr Putin spoke with his human rights council via video-conference on Wednesday. He also complained that Western rights organisations viewed Russia as "a second-class country that has no right to exist at all"."There can be only one answer from our side - a consistent struggle for our national interests," he said.Mr Putin said the country would accomplish this by "various ways and means", and that it would firstly focus on "peaceful means".
